The Growing Popularity of Smart Faucets

As smart faucets are gaining more popularity in average as well as luxury houses, as they help enhance the level of hygiene, convenience, and water savings. Nowadays, many faucets have motion detection, voice commands, touchless controls, adjustable temperatures, water monitoring, and even automatic shut-off functions.

These features prove very useful for fast-paced kitchen environments that require the user’s multitasking skills. The users do not need to turn on the water using any faucet handle as they can control it in different ways, which can also save them from the risk of spreading bacteria. Many designers believe touchless fixtures will soon become essential elements of modern kitchen design due to their practicality and sleek appearance. 

Water Efficiency Is Becoming a Major Priority

Sustainability currently forms one of the most powerful factors behind the design of kitchens today. With water conservation becoming more and more essential, advanced water technology is enabling consumers to save on their daily water use without compromising on ease of use.

Some examples of innovative water technologies are:

  • Flow control systems
  • Leakage sensing systems
  • Advanced water filters
  • Thermostat controls
  • Water saving mode

The EPA says that water efficient appliances could lead to savings of up to 20% in household water consumption.

Source: EPA WaterSense Program

This growing focus on sustainability is influencing every aspect of modular kitchen design, especially in urban homes where efficiency and resource management matter more than ever.

Smart faucets also help homeowners monitor water usage through connected mobile applications, making it easier to track consumption and reduce waste over time.

Smart Technology Is Influencing Renovation Costs

With the increase in the adoption of complex technologies in the kitchen, the factors that need consideration during the remodeling of a kitchen are also evolving.

Even though installing intelligent faucets and water systems will result in an increased cost of remodeling your kitchen initially, most people see these as investments due to:

  • Reduced utility bills
  • Energy efficiency
  • Minimal maintenance
  • Increased house value

Furthermore, the cost will depend on:

  • Changes in plumbing systems
  • Preparation for smart homes
  • Installation complexity
  • Materials quality
  • Additional automation components

Hygiene and Health Are Driving Demand

Yet another big reason why these devices have become so common is their relation to hygiene.

The use of touchless technology makes sure there is less direct contact made with surfaces, which tend to be a lot more prone to carrying bacteria due to cooking or cleaning processes.

Such devices come equipped with various features such as:

  • Motion-sensing water supply
  • Self-closing water taps
  • Systems that supply filtered drinking water
  • Antibacterial coatings

More and more health conscious consumers see them as an investment towards better living rather than a mere luxury item.
